What Are Non UK Licensed Online Casinos?

Non UK licensed online casinos are gambling venues that operate under licenses issued by authorities outside of the United Kingdom. While UK gambling establishments are regulated by the UK Gambling Commission, which ensures that operators adhere to strict guidelines, non UK establishments can be licensed by various regulatory bodies around the world. This allows them to offer services to players in the UK, despite not being under the same jurisdiction.

The Risks of Non UK Licensed Online Casinos

While there are significant advantages, it is crucial for players to be aware of the risks associated with non UK licensed online casinos:

  • Less Regulation: Without the stringent regulations imposed by the UK Gambling Commission, players may be more vulnerable to fraudulent operations or unfair practices.
  • Difficulties in Dispute Resolution: Disputes may be harder to resolve with non UK licensed casinos, as the legal framework may not provide the same consumer protections as UK casinos.
  • Withdrawal Challenges: Players might encounter issues withdrawing their winnings, especially if the casino is less reputable or has unclear withdrawal policies.
  • Legal Uncertainties: Gambling laws differ significantly from one country to another, and engaging with non UK licensed casinos may involve navigating a complex legal landscape.

Popular Non UK Licensed Online Casino Markets

Non UK licensed online casinos can be found in various jurisdictions, each presenting unique advantages and regulations. Some popular markets include:

  • Curaçao: Known for its lenient licensing process, many online casinos operate under Curaçao licenses, offering a range of games and generous bonuses.
  • Maltese Casinos: Malta is home to several reputable online casinos, known for adhering to strong regulatory standards while offering a wide variety of games.
  • Gibraltar: Gibraltar is another respected licensing jurisdiction, with operators provided a reputable gambling environment and often offering favorable tax agreements.
  • Kahnawake: Based in Canada, the Kahnawake Gaming Commission offers licenses to several online casinos, providing a reliable and transparent gaming experience.
